Output d405445e3ecb28f562b61e926544d420eaff67ba51470da7079b8400becefaf4:3

value
621000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f687224d034cca27d93afacbbc356e5dd5157eb OP_EQUALVERIFY OP_CHECKSIG
address
16nGh7VNWEHaHLfCrhAexeQCfsdZpSCRKa
transaction
d405445e3ecb28f562b61e926544d420eaff67ba51470da7079b8400becefaf4
spent
true